Transaction 2074903059ea86eaddc0b56744a05386478fa4f469bd6de2357fb88bb8c1d008
1 Input
1 Output
-
2074903059ea86eaddc0b56744a05386478fa4f469bd6de2357fb88bb8c1d008:0
- value
- 1716750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cacf0160e244d91ea6f804d62dda850c7a68cd3 OP_EQUAL
- address
- 3Qj3NpK9STsLEzBGhARoBuKauGfiQq75Vy